12 M.R.S. Chapter 206-A Use Regulation:
The LUPC statute is the land use law that created the Maine Land Use Planning Commission and identified the mission of the agency.
The Commission's statute is available for viewing at our office in Augusta or from any of the Commission's regional offices.
